The AI image upscaler increases pixel dimensions and estimates sharper edges. The output is usually a larger JPG or PNG that looks cleaner on screens and small prints.

A free upscaler works best when the source photo already has recognizable detail. The free ai image upscaler can make faces, clothing texture, product edges, and pet fur look cleaner. The free ai image upscaler cannot recover a license plate, handwritten note, or tiny logo when the original pixels are too damaged. What free ai image upscaler tools still get wrong

  • A free ai image upscaler can invent face texture when the original portrait is extremely blurry, which can create plastic skin or uneven eyes.
  • Tiny text can become warped, mirrored, or unreadable after upscaling because AI models guess shapes rather than recover exact letters from missing pixels.
  • Hands, jewelry, eyelashes, and hair flyaways can look strange when the source photo lacks clean edges or has heavy motion blur.
  • Product photos with fabric patterns, mesh, or reflective surfaces can gain fake texture that was not present in the original image.
  • Screenshots and logos can lose crisp geometry because raster upscaling is not the same as creating a clean vector file.
